Output dd4fed1e7cbbddb0dc783986a734585aa098625868866cd909285a233f65aef3:1

value
18760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ed6767d394af71e7f30705049db4b27e2d5fd86f OP_EQUAL
address
3PLHwkcG9tezAERhHsXSMABbpcqtunu39B
transaction
dd4fed1e7cbbddb0dc783986a734585aa098625868866cd909285a233f65aef3
spent
true